Output 7d3f6ce1e58903617f95e8820247928c6cc65b04676eac25c68c72903b6b29e3:0

value
1022497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c3b84b5b8b718819f54e7f82c67e0d59a1fe9fd OP_EQUAL
address
35itxPsHFUG7y1puT4uSbDATAyJfCdnvvx
transaction
7d3f6ce1e58903617f95e8820247928c6cc65b04676eac25c68c72903b6b29e3
spent
true